The opener is not the entire story

One of one of the most common errors house owners make is thinking every symptom points to the opener. Occasionally it does. In some cases the opener is merely the component that reveals trouble elsewhere.

A door that is properly stabilized ought to move as planned without obvious pressure. When it is not well balanced, the opener might appear weak, noisy, inconsistent, or unpredictable. The temptation is to change the electric motor unit or remote controls, especially if you have been searching Residential Garage Door Openers or Residential Garage Door https://www.higginsoverheaddoor.com/garage-door-repair-cedar-lake-indiana Accessories and already have items in mind. Yet a new opener connected to a door that binds or sticks does not solve the hidden problem. In the worst situations, it conceals it momentarily and then falls short under the same stress.

This is why good repair work begins with diagnosis, not with a hurried components sale. Home owners take advantage of recognizing that an opener repair work phone call may turn into a door-system assessment. That is not immediately upselling. Often it is the only straightforward means to resolve the problem.

Balance is a safety and security issue, not an aesthetic one

The word stabilized can seem obscure, however in practice it is one of the clearest signals of a healthy and balanced or undesirable garage door system. Government customer security guidance especially claims a residential garage door ought to be well balanced, which if it binds, sticks, or is unbalanced, it needs to be serviced by a professional.

That guidance matters for two reasons. First, an out of balance door areas additional stress and anxiety on the opener. Second, imbalance typically aims towards components of the system that house owners ought to not try to repair by themselves. The same safety guidance states to have a competent service individual repair cables, springtime settings up, and various other equipment prior to installing an opener. The logic is simple. If the weight-handling parts are not functioning properly, the automation devices is being asked to do a job it can not securely manage alone.

Homeowners occasionally define an out of balance system in practical terms as opposed to technical ones. The door "feels heavy." It "is reluctant midway." It "jerks at the start." It "imitates the opener is passing away." Those summaries are useful since they tell a technician what the property owner is seeing, however they need to also tell the house owner something vital: this is no more a simple benefit problem. It is currently a repair service choice with security consequences.

Why contemporary entrapment defense deserves your attention

If your household uses automatic operation daily, the safety includes on the opener are not optional information. They are the reason a modern-day opener can be trusted at all.

Federal safety assistance for automatic property garage door openers produced on or after January 1, 1991 requires entrapment defense under policies connected to UL 325. For home owners, the functional takeaway is basic. If you have an automatic opener, the security system that assists avoid entrapment is main to the device's secure procedure. If the door shuts unpredictably, turns around when it should not, or acts in ways you do not comprehend, it is worth treating that concern seriously rather than normalizing it.

A great deal of people obtain made use of to traits. They find out that the remote "needs a second press," or that the door "normally closes if no one walks by." That type of adjustment is dangerous since it shifts interest far from the underlying fault. When an opener's safety-related actions adjustments, you are no more taking care of a small nuisance. You are handling a feature that exists because major injuries can occur when a garage door system is not running as intended.

What you can observe prior to you call for service

Homeowners do not need to come to be professionals. They do need to become precise viewers. That alone can conserve time, develop the service telephone call, and minimize the odds of paying for guesswork.

Before you contact a company, take notice of when the trouble occurs. Does the door bind each time, or throughout closing? Does the wall control behave differently from the remote? Is the issue constant, or does it appear random? A service technician who hears a clear pattern can frequently tighten the likely reasons much faster than one who gets just "it quit working."

There is additionally a sensible cash problem here. Customer support out of commission settings generally keeps in mind that diagnostic work may be billed separately, and that consumers must ask whether a diagnostic cost still applies if they determine not to proceed with the repair service. That is a wise question in garage door service as well. Diagnosis requires time. There is nothing inherently incorrect with an analysis fee. The issue is when homeowners never ever ask, presume the solution call covers whatever, and are then pressured right into prompt authorization due to the fact that they really feel cornered by shock fees.

A brief pre-call list helps:

  1. Note whether the door binds, sticks, or seems unbalanced.
  2. Write down exactly what the opener does, consisting of turnarounds or inconsistent response.
  3. Ask whether there is an analysis charge, also if you decrease the repair.
  4. Request a composed estimate that describes work, materials, timing, and price.
  5. Confirm who is involving your home and just how the firm determines its technicians.

That list is simple purposefully. It does not ask you to identify components. It asks you to collect realities and secure yourself.

Why some repair work should never ever be a DIY experiment

There is a strong do-it-yourself touch in homeownership, and usually it offers individuals well. Paint, trim, basic maintenance, even some device tasks, those can be sensible weekend break tasks. Garage door systems are different.

Federal security support specifically states wires, spring assemblies, and other hardware must be fixed by a qualified service individual prior to an opener is installed. That declaration is slim, yet its ramification is broad. The weight-bearing and tension-related components of a garage door system are not informal repair products. If they are part of the problem, the property owner's role is to quit guessing and begin vetting a genuine professional.

That is specifically essential when frustration is high. A stuck garage door can catch a car, disrupt a day, and create prompt stress to get someone out quickly. Seriousness is exactly when people come to be prone to criminals, unclear rates, and unneeded replacement recommendations.

Choosing a repair work company without obtaining played

Search web traffic around expressions like residential garage door repair work near me and residential garage doors near me is built on necessity. Scammers recognize that. They know many homeowners will click the first result, make the very first telephone call, and agree to nearly anything if it seems quick.

Consumer security support gives homeowners a solid filter. A legit business needs to have verifiable get in touch with details, identifiable branding, and a genuine physical location. The Bbb has actually advised that rip-off operations may utilize phony addresses or present themselves as regional when they are not. That issues because a real physical presence is one of the easiest ways to differentiate a solution business that guarantees its work from one that vanishes after payment.

The same assistance advises requesting for evidence of insurance policy, licensing where appropriate, certifications, and identification. Licensing regulations differ by place, so property owners need to verify requirements with neighborhood authorities rather than presuming every company encounters the same standards. The Federal Profession Commission also recommends verifying a specialist's permit with state or area federal government and getting a composed agreement before job begins.

A legit service go to must feel recognizable. The BBB keeps in mind that genuine technicians commonly use uniforms, bring identification, and show up in company-branded lorries. None of those details alone verifies top quality, but together they develop responsibility. Accountability is what you desire when somebody is diagnosing a safety-related issue affixed to the largest moving things in your home.

Red flags that are worthy of a prompt no

Some warning signs are refined. Others are so typical that home owners should memorize them prior to they ever before require service.

  • The company can not offer a verifiable physical area or makes use of a suspicious address.
  • The specialist pressures you to authorize job promptly without clear composed terms.
  • The quote is significantly less than others, after that balloons after arrival.
  • You are asked for full repayment upfront.
  • No proof of insurance policy, recognition, credentials, or relevant licensing is offered.

Those are not minor service quirks. They are traditional signs that the house owner is being maneuvered rather than served.

Very low service-call offers should have special hesitation. Consumer defense companies have cautioned that "too excellent to be true" pricing is usually the hook, not the final price. The homeowner publications the consultation because the number appears harmless. When the technician gets here, the tale modifications. Unexpectedly the trouble is serious, replacement is immediate, and the billing births no resemblance to the initial promise. A repair work telephone call that started with a bargain ends with pressure, confusion, and a costs the home owner never ever would certainly have accepted in advance.

Estimates, agreements, and the self-control of getting it in writing

Good repair work and excellent documentation tend to take a trip with each other. If a business is sincere regarding the work, it generally has no issue putting the information in writing.

Consumer guidance advises obtaining whatever in writing, consisting of extent of work, products, and costs. The FTC adds that a composed estimate needs to describe the work, products, conclusion day, and rate. That level of information issues since garage door fixing typically occurs under time pressure. A homeowner desires the door functioning again. The specialist desires authorization. Clear documents slows the procedure just enough to keep it honest.

Written terms safeguard both sides. They minimize misunderstandings about whether a go to was analysis only or included repair service, whether the estimated rate covers materials, and whether the work being advised addresses the opener, the door hardware, or both. They likewise make window shopping possible. The BBB recommends getting several price quotes when suitable and being wary of unusually reduced quotes.

That factor is worthy of emphasis. Cost alone is not knowledge. A low quote may reflect performance, or it may show noninclusion. It might omit labor steps, required products, or the true nature of the trouble. On the various other hand, the greatest price quote is not immediately the most detailed. The written range is what allows you contrast real propositions rather than unclear promises.
